Inflationary phase in Generalized Brans-Dicke theory

General Relativity and Quantum Cosmology 2010-12-14 v2

Abstract

We find a solution for exponential inflation in a Brans-Dicke generalized model, where the coupling "constant " is variable. While in General Relativity the equation of state is p is equal to minus rho, here we find p proportional to rho, where the proportionality constant is smaller than -2/3. The negativity of cosmic pressure implies acceleration of the expansion, even with lambda < 0 >.
